logo

DeepSeek智能体实战指南:从工具到固定任务执行者的进阶路径

作者:蛮不讲李2025.09.17 15:38浏览量:0

简介:本文聚焦DeepSeek智能体的构建方法,通过任务定义、API集成、工作流设计、异常处理四大模块,详细解析如何将DeepSeek转化为可自动执行固定任务的智能系统,助力开发者实现AI驱动的流程自动化。

引言:从工具到智能体的价值跃迁

在AI技术快速迭代的当下,DeepSeek凭借其强大的自然语言处理能力已成为开发者手中的”瑞士军刀”。但单纯依赖手动交互的模式已无法满足企业级应用对效率、稳定性和可扩展性的需求。将DeepSeek转化为智能体(Agent),使其能够自主感知环境、执行任务并持续优化,正成为AI工程化的重要方向。

一、智能体构建的核心要素

1.1 任务定义与边界划定

智能体的有效性始于对任务的精准定义。开发者需通过”5W1H”框架(What/Why/Who/When/Where/How)明确任务目标:

  • What:具体执行动作(如数据抓取、报告生成)
  • Why:业务价值与成功标准
  • Who:涉及角色与权限
  • When:触发条件与执行频率
  • Where:数据源与输出位置
  • How:技术实现路径

案例:某电商平台的智能体需每日9点自动抓取竞品价格,生成对比报告并邮件发送至运营团队。通过明确时间、数据源、输出格式等要素,将抽象需求转化为可执行指令。

1.2 API集成与能力封装

DeepSeek的智能体化依赖其开放的API接口。开发者需掌握:

  • 认证机制:OAuth2.0或API Key的配置
  • 请求封装:构造符合规范的JSON请求体
    ```python
    import requests

def call_deepseek_api(prompt, api_key):
url = “https://api.deepseek.com/v1/chat/completions
headers = {
“Authorization”: f”Bearer {api_key}”,
“Content-Type”: “application/json”
}
data = {
“model”: “deepseek-chat”,
“messages”: [{“role”: “user”, “content”: prompt}],
“temperature”: 0.3
}
response = requests.post(url, headers=headers, json=data)
return response.json()

  1. - **响应解析**:提取关键信息并转换为结构化数据
  2. ## 二、固定任务执行系统的设计
  3. ### 2.1 工作流编排技术
  4. 实现自动化任务执行需构建清晰的工作流:
  5. 1. **触发层**:定时任务(Cron)、事件驱动(Webhook)或手动触发
  6. 2. **处理层**:
  7. - 输入预处理:数据清洗、格式转换
  8. - 核心逻辑:调用DeepSeek API执行任务
  9. - 输出后处理:结果验证、格式标准化
  10. 3. **存储层**:任务日志、中间结果、最终输出的持久化
  11. *工具推荐*:Airflow(任务编排)、Celery(异步任务)、Redis(缓存)
  12. ### 2.2 状态管理与上下文保持
  13. 智能体需在多轮交互中维持状态:
  14. - **会话ID**:通过唯一标识关联上下文
  15. - **记忆机制**:
  16. - 短期记忆:当前会话的上下文窗口
  17. - 长期记忆:外部数据库存储的关键信息
  18. ```python
  19. class AgentMemory:
  20. def __init__(self):
  21. self.session_cache = {}
  22. self.knowledge_base = {} # 长期记忆
  23. def get_context(self, session_id):
  24. return self.session_cache.get(session_id, [])
  25. def update_context(self, session_id, new_messages):
  26. if session_id not in self.session_cache:
  27. self.session_cache[session_id] = []
  28. self.session_cache[session_id].extend(new_messages)

三、可靠性增强策略

3.1 异常处理机制

构建健壮的智能体需预设多种异常场景:

  • API限流:实现指数退避重试
    ```python
    import time
    from requests.exceptions import HTTPError

def safe_api_call(func, max_retries=3):
for attempt in range(max_retries):
try:
return func()
except HTTPError as e:
if e.response.status_code == 429: # 限流
wait_time = min(2**attempt, 30)
time.sleep(wait_time)
else:
raise
raise Exception(“Max retries exceeded”)
```

  • 结果验证:通过正则表达式或模型校验输出合法性
  • 降级策略:备用方案触发条件与执行路径

3.2 监控与优化体系

建立完整的监控链路:

  • 指标采集
    • 成功率(Success Rate)
    • 平均响应时间(ART)
    • 成本效率(Tokens/Task)
  • 告警机制:阈值触发与通知渠道
  • 持续优化
    • A/B测试不同参数组合
    • 反馈循环强化模型表现

四、行业应用实践

4.1 金融风控场景

某银行构建的智能体可自动完成:

  1. 每日抓取监管政策更新
  2. 解析政策要点并映射至内部风控指标
  3. 生成合规报告并推送至相关团队
    通过预设的关键词库和语义分析模型,实现98%的准确率。

4.2 制造业设备维护

工厂中的智能体执行:

  • 实时采集设备传感器数据
  • 调用DeepSeek分析异常模式
  • 自动生成维护工单并分配至技术人员
    系统上线后,设备停机时间减少40%。

五、进阶技巧与注意事项

5.1 性能优化

  • 批处理:合并多个小任务减少API调用
  • 缓存策略:存储常用查询结果
  • 模型微调:针对特定领域优化表现

5.2 安全合规

  • 数据脱敏:敏感信息处理
  • 访问控制:基于角色的权限管理
  • 审计日志:完整操作轨迹记录

5.3 跨平台集成

  • 与企业微信/钉钉等协作工具对接
  • 连接数据库、消息队列等基础设施
  • 支持RESTful/gRPC等多种接口协议

结语:智能体的未来演进

随着DeepSeek等大模型能力的持续提升,智能体正从简单的任务执行者向具备自主决策能力的AI助手进化。开发者需在工程实现中平衡效率、可靠性与成本,构建真正符合业务需求的智能系统。未来,多智能体协作、自主进化等方向将进一步拓展AI的应用边界。

通过本文介绍的架构设计、技术实现和最佳实践,开发者可快速构建具备固定任务执行能力的DeepSeek智能体,为业务自动化注入AI动能。建议从简单场景切入,逐步迭代复杂度,在实践中积累智能体开发的核心能力。

相关文章推荐

发表评论